With the Accessories business unit, Bosch Power Tools is the world’s leading supplier of accessories for home users, craftsmen, and industrial customers. At the subsidiary Scintilla AG in St. Niklaus, a workforce of around 800 employees worldwide develops, manufactures, and sells over 8,000 accessory items for power tools.

Job Description
As an Industrial Engineer (Work Planner) with a focus on time management and ergonomics (m/f/div.), you are responsible for analyzing and optimizing workflows in our plant. You take on the cross-site control function for the completeness and accuracy of working time specifications and operating models.
Your main tasks include:
- Conducting time studies using REFA and MTM
- Target/actual comparisons of work plans and development of recommendations for action
- Determining distribution times for manufacturing processes at the site
- Conducting workplace assessments
- Contributing know-how during the development phase of self-constructed new systems regarding time management and ergonomics
- Evaluating the ergonomics of workplaces using the Bosch "ErgoCheck" method.
- Initiating and implementing improvement measures in the area of ergonomics
